We are thrilled to share that the MHS Ballfields Project received official approval from the Town of Marshfield in April 2025 and is now working to enter the construction phase this summer! This exciting initiative impacts all four town ballfields (Baseball and Softball) at the Marshfield High School Sports Complex, with a strong focus on improving safety, accessibility, and playability across the entire facility.
The centerpiece of the project is the much-needed revitalization of the Varsity Baseball field, which will include:
While the town-approved Community Preservation Committee (CPC) budget provides funding for critical infrastructure—such as site preparation and concrete slabs for dugouts—it only supports the relocation of the existing dugouts at Varsity Baseball.
